Administered by AISES for the Burlington Northern Santa Fe Foundation, this scholarship is made available to American Indian high school seniors who reside in one of the 13 states serviced by the Burlington Northern and Santa Fe Pacific Corporation and its affiliated companies: Arizona, California, Colorado, Kansas, Minnesota, Montana, New Mexico, North Dakota, Oklahoma, Oregon, South Dakota, Texas and Washington. This award is for four years (for a maximum of 8 semesters) until baccalaureate degree is obtained, whichever occurs first. Those awarded must maintain a 2.0 GPA their freshman and sophomore years, and a 3.0 GPA their junior and senior years to receive full award. Awarded students do not have to reapply for this award each year.
Scholarship Amount:
$2,500 per academic year, up to 4 years.
5 awards made each year.
Eligible Degrees: Business, Mathematics, Natural/Physical Sciences, Technology, Engineering, Education, Medicine, or Health Administration
Other Criteria:
A) Must be a high school senior anticipating successful graduation in June or of the year application is submitted.
B) Must attend an accredited four-year college/university as a full-time student starting fall 2014.
C) Must have a 2.0 or higher cumulative grade point average (GPA).
D) Must be an enrolled member of an American Indian tribe, Alaska Native, or Native Hawaiian or otherwise considered to be an American Indian by the tribe with which affiliation is claimed; or is at least 1/4 American Indian blood; or is at least 1/4 Alaskan Native; or considered to be an Alaskan Native by an Alaskan Native group to which affiliation is claimed.
E) Must be a current AISES member.
